Chapter 1375 Joint Venture

"Our Jilikang company is willing to join." The door of the conference room was pushed open, and a fat white man with a round head and a round head came in.

"Yang Rui!" The fat white man shouted loudly and opened his arms.

"Mr. Frank?" Yang Rui stood up in surprise and hugged the white Frank.

Franky tightened his arm before letting Yang Rui go, cracked his mouth and laughed in English: "I'm really sorry, when I received the notice, I was still in South Africa and had no flight to Beijing..."

He explained why he came late, and pointed to the Chinese behind him and said, "I asked Manager Lin to send me here from Tianjin, but I didn't expect to be late... However, our Jilikan's mood to want a joint venture remains unchanged."

"It's good to come, sit down first." Yang Rui was obviously tolerant of Frankie.

When she was still in West Fort Middle School, Yang Rui had a deal with Frank. Later, when the West Fort Factory was established, Frank came forward again.

In general, Franky is the person Yang Rui is most familiar with in Jielikon and he is also relatively trusted.

At least, it is much more trustworthy than foreigners who have never met before.

Although they are all here to make money and run around for profit, foreigners are also friendly, and Franky will cherish the relationship he knows about the Nobel Prize winners.

"Mr. Yang Rui, congratulations on winning the Nobel Prize." Frank took out a brocade box from his pocket and gave it to Yang Rui solemnly, saying: "This is a gadget I got in South Africa, please accept it."

According to foreign customs, Yang Rui opened the brocade box and saw a beautiful sapphire inside.

"This gift is a bit heavy." Yang Rui didn't know if South Africa produces sapphires, but even if it was produced, it wouldn't be too cheap.

"You won the Nobel Prize. No matter what, you should give me a gift that you can get." Franky spoke with a very Chinese template and was looked up by the translator.

Leander said that he was going to quit, but he did not leave the conference room. At this time, he looked at the sapphire in the brocade box given by Franke, and thought of the smear he gave, and couldn't help but glar at his translator fiercely.

The little translator was also helpless. Looking at Yang Rui, he thought to himself: Who knows that you received gifts so fiercely?

"I didn't expect that Jielikan came over to find you. What do you think about the joint venture?" Yang Rui asked Frank with a happy look.

Leander glanced at him enviously again. This was a treatment that no one else received.

Frank also knew this was an important opportunity and hurriedly said: "Jelican's policy is flexible. We really hope to get a controlling stake in the pharmaceutical factory and the valuation can also be floating. If not, we are willing to accept a 50% distribution plan."

This is also the feedback given by Frank. It seems that he has taken a step back, but in fact it also retains a lot of bargaining space.

Yang Rui smiled, nodded, nodded, and said, "For the specific plan, you have to talk to the Chemical Pharmaceutical Revitalization Office. I am only responsible for the ion channel laboratory."

"I understand." Franky looked at understanding.

He had been on Yang Rui's side before, suppressing the foreign trade of the Chinese medicine and was so breathless that Frankie thought that he would probably have the same requirement at this time.

Yang Rui did not explain that he had 100% of his own Huarui Pharmaceuticals in his name, but he lacked interest in this state-owned enterprise with an uncertain form.

This is a factory that needs to accommodate tens of thousands of workers. Just like most state-owned enterprises in the late 1980s, its function has changed from profitable to accommodate as many people as possible.

The so-called social responsibility is now a heavy burden for state-owned enterprises and factories.

Foreign pharmaceutical companies such as Jielikang have both foreign sales stimulus and the need to establish domestic relations and sales networks, so they can tolerate unprofitable pharmaceutical factories.

Yang Rui was no longer interested in this, and the country probably couldn't stand the fact that a scholar invested in a state-owned enterprise in his personal name. Yang Rui didn't want to not eat mutton, so he would make him flirt with it first.

"Another thing is, the drug development of the new factory is carried out by the Peking University Ion Channel Laboratory, and the cost and ownership of the new drug are also belonged to the Ion Channel Laboratory." Yang Rui gave another shot of the vaccine.

Several white men looked at each other and could only make a default decision.

Of course they don’t like this model, but it’s not only China that bullies customers by big stores. Yang Rui, who won the Nobel Prize, has no shortage of funding and fame and channels, so they can only choose to join or not.

"Come on, we'll drive here..." Yang Rui finished his work and stood up immediately. What he was most unhappy about now was wasting time.

"I'm just here to arrive at the laboratory. Can you visit the ion channel laboratory?" Huo Thoren made a request before Yang Rui officially ended.

Yang Rui thought for a while and said, "Then let's visit. There is no preparation. Xiao Wang, please bring it to you."

He simply didn't plan to take people to visit.

Fortunately, everyone's focus is not on him, so it doesn't matter who will take him to visit.

Including Frank, I would rather confirm the strength of the Ion Channel Laboratory.

In the Chemical Medicine Revitalization Office, Director Hu Chi and former Secretary Hu frowned deeply as they looked at the documents submitted by Yang Rui.

Yang Rui’s plan looks beautiful, like a story full of dreams.

What Hu Chi read from it was too much nonsense.

It is already a very difficult task to rebuild North China Pharmaceutical in another place. Although the imminent problem was solved through the Party School, Yang Rui actually proposed to invite foreign companies to join the joint venture with the newly named "Northern United Pharmaceutical". Secretary Hu still felt that it was too ideal.

A joint venture is certainly a good thing.

First of all, foreign companies can bring advanced management and production experience, which is something China needs very much.

On the other hand, foreign companies can also bring enviable foreign investment.

Foreign capital is foreign exchange, and the foreign exchange represented by foreign capital must be settled at the official exchange rate in accordance with national requirements.

Why do foreign capital always sign agreements with great advantage in so many cases? Many times, it is because foreign exchange is hard currency and the RMB is inflationary goods.

If a company can reach a joint venture, the bank will kneel down and send a loan without asking.

Therefore, the key to the problem has returned to the possibility of joint ventures.

Why do foreign companies have joint ventures with Northern United Pharmaceutical, which has nothing but a bunch of workers?

Although he has been working in Qiaoban for a while, Secretary Hu still believes that joint ventures are very difficult.

He has seen too many joint venture negotiations between state-owned enterprises. Although the documents are always incomplete, Secretary Hu can still detect the various problems encountered by the joint venture between the lines.

Equity distribution, corporate valuation, supporting policies, employee policies and other issues cannot be achieved by having a heart that wants to succeed.

Many times, the head of the company makes concessions step by step at the request of the representatives of the foreign company, and in the end, the joint venture is still not reached.

Before this, in order to avoid bottom-line cooperation, the central government repeatedly made various requirements for joint ventures. These red lines were often the death line of the enterprise.

"I thought so well, how can things go in the direction you want." Hu Chi sighed and thought silently in his heart that even if you win the Nobel Prize, you can't let the earth circulate around you.

"Send a letter to a few foreign companies and see how many are willing to come to discuss." Hu Chi left the office and threw the documents to his secretary. Before returning, he said: "You have to carefully ask the other party's wishes, there is no need to force them. In addition, whether it is a foreign company that has been in the process or a state-owned enterprise that has indeed intended, you need to identify and mark it."

Hu Chi thought to himself that if there is no foreign company that is really willing to negotiate a joint venture, it would be better to go abroad to purchase according to the established plan.
